I loved this book. It is understated but brilliant; sweet and clever and heartbreaking. Set over a twelve-hour period, this book sees Clare and Aidan on their last night before college. The countdown throughout the book gave it a sense of urgency, a feeling that this couple are racing against time. It made a nice change to read about an established couple, who are reliving the best moments of their two year relationship. So many Young Adult books are about the beginning of romance - the build up - rather than the comfortable day-to-day reality of a long term relationship. I was impressed by the maturity that Clare and Aidan showed as they came to their decision. I cried a lot during the last few chapters, reminded of my own experiences, but I loved the open ending. This felt like grown up YA (almost NA) with the transition to adulthood almost complete. This is definitely a book I will re-read and I'll also be looking up Jennifer E. Smith's other books.
